The Cahaba Task as well as older city existed as independent communities for several yrs, Nonetheless they combined if the city of Trussville was incorporated in 1947. The next 12 months, the government offered all park property to your city for 1 dollar, turned in excess of to Trussville the h2o system it experienced developed, and offered challenge residences to residents or other purchasers. The town also manufactured a normal fuel process that now serves Trussville and outlying communities.

Bridge in excess of the Cahaba River in Trussville Prior to the territorial interval, the world that now encompasses Trussville was Section of the Creek Nation. White settlers began transferring into north central Alabama trussville alabama after the American Revolution. One particular early settler, Warren Truss (for whom the town is named), created a grist mill together the Cahaba River while in the early 1820s. Fertile land along with a abundant water offer captivated Other folks, and a settlement identified at some time as "Truss" sprang up several miles south of your mill. The settlement's early economic system centered all-around agriculture, with yeoman farmers elevating livestock, cotton, grains, and greens.
